"GM, Ford and Toyota sales drop in April; Chrysler Group makes gains"

US Auto sales fall by 8%, but Chrysler group jumps pretty good....

* Jeep® brand up 29 percent led by Jeep Wrangler and Jeep Patriot
* Chrysler and Dodge minivans up 10 percent with momentum from “National Minivan Month” in April
* Five-star crash test-rated Dodge Ram pick up rises 2 percent in competitive segment
* Chrysler Sebring sedan rises 56 percent

Another angle to look at this general downturn: (and give kudos to Chrysler Group)

#1 - Jeep had the biggest jump....and they are VERY POOR EPA FUEL ECONOMY


General Motors: Down 9 Percent
Ford: Down 13 Percent
Chrysler Group: Up 1.6 Percent
Chrysler Group by brand:
Chrysler: Up 7 percent
Dodge: Up 2 percent
Jeep: Up 40 percent

Toyota USA: Down 4.3 Percent
Honda USA: Down 9.1 percent
Nissan: Down 18 percent
BMW: Up 0.5 percent
Mini Cooper: Up 2.1 percent

Mercedes: Down 1.8 percent
Audi: Up 9.4 percent
Volkswagen: Down 7 percent
Hyundai: Down 4.6 percent
